About The Position

The Investment and Legacy Advisor plays a pivotal role in building deep, trusted relationships with our members by providing personalized investment and estate planning solutions. This role is primarily focused on the management and expansion of our segregated fund’s portfolio, while also helping members consolidate their assets under the reliable and trusted umbrella of Coast Capital. You’ll be responsible for delivering tailored, tax-efficient investment strategies, monitoring and rebalancing portfolios, and ensuring full regulatory compliance. This role also involves evaluating clients’ financial goals and risk tolerance, and proactively adapting financial strategies as life circumstances change. This position is more than just portfolio management, it’s about helping our members feel confident about their financial futures and supporting them with a clear, strategic approach to investment and legacy planning.

Requirements

  • Minimum 4–6 years of experience in a related role, with 7–9 years of direct financial services sales experience, including at least 5 years in insurance and estate planning.
  • High school diploma plus completion of a Certificate Program (equivalent to one full year or 10 courses); a university degree is considered an asset.
  • LLQP (Life License Qualification Program) certification is mandatory.
  • Demonstrated success in managing segregated fund portfolios and developing tax-efficient investment strategies.
  • Strong knowledge of financial regulatory compliance requirements specific to segregated funds.
  • Solid understanding of estate planning principles as they relate to investment and insurance products.
  • Proven ability to deliver engaging financial presentations and lead educational client sessions.
  • Skilled in using CRM systems and other digital financial tools.
  • Proficiency in the full consultative sales process with a strong focus on results.
  • Exceptional relationship-building and communication skills.

Nice To Haves

  • Certified Financial Planner (CFP) and Chartered Life Underwriter (CLU) designations are highly advantageous.
